		<content:encoded><![CDATA[ We lost our precious Pooh last night after a short battle with cancer.  Last month Pooh wasn't feeling well and we took him to see Dr. Martha.  All seemed ok so she gave him pain medication for his hip displasia and he did extremely well.  He was like a new dog.  Dr. Martha wanted to see him back in 30 days.  We had him to the groomer and the next day he didn't seem to feel well.  We took him back to Dr. Martha for his follow up visit and x-rays when she discovered Pooh had cancer.  Pooh died at home with his Mommy and Daddy with him only 2 days later.  
Pooh was truly a one of a kind Chow Chow.  Pooh could always make you laugh, he was sweet, tender, gentle, loving, unselfish, fun, the list goes on.  Pooh touched many lives in his short life and he will be greatly missed.]]></content:encoded>
